Over the past 20 years, Guido Perrini has been the man behind the camera for some of the defining moments of freeriding. While accompanying boundary-breaking snowboarders and skiers like Xavier de la Rue, Jérémie Heitz and Sam Anthamatten on their ever-more-ambitious projects, Perrini has experienced both the highs and the lows of this dangerous but rewarding way of life. Now with two decades of freeride filmmaking under his belt in some of the world’s most exotic ski locations, Perrini has marked this milestone with “Twenty” — an introspective look back at his years spent documenting the sport while asking the crucial question: Was it all worth it?
